Within the book where I made my drawings / sketches – I would also start keeping a form of diary.

Here, I would write everyday about how I felt, what I did and how I did in terms of keeping up with particular goals. I would set myself particular goals, whether it was in the form of calories, weight or exercise. Depending on how I did – my writing would either be ‘happy’ and ‘positive’ if I had kept up with my goal or did ‘better’ – and would be ‘negative’ and literally me insulting myself, if things hadn’t gone according to plan. When I was busy managing my thoughts (which I wrote about in Day 157: Generating an Eating Disorder – The Power of Thoughts - Part 1) I would also ‘practise’ insulting myself where I would swear at myself if I fucked up – I had a really hard time with that one, and it felt completely stupid, awkward and fake to be calling myself a ‘stupid bitch’ for instance. I never would previously insult or swear at myself so this point I transferred to writing, where I would practice ‘bashing’ myself. It was awkward at first, but I got better at it. The writing was always more to induce some kind of emotional response inside myself – where I used writing and words to ‘work myself up’ to get to a particular emotional state like being very sad or very angry.

After a while I would also start keeping diagrams and graphs in terms of how my weight was progressing over time – where I would have one chart/graph in terms of how I would like things to go and another one showing how things actually were moving (which was of course a different story).

So I would write, write, write – which was like me ‘winding myself up’ like some mechanical doll – then I’d have achieved a particular ‘state of mind’ which I would use to manipulate myself to be in a ‘bad spot’ from which I would then ‘push’ myself out into the opposite direction in terms of re-committing and motivating myself to a point of ‘I’m gonna do this’ and ‘I’m going to get there’.

This is where I saw that emotions are not always reactions as things that just ‘happen’, but is something that one can actually create and generate and use to influence oneself in one way or another. And within this also, how writing can be used to wire yourself up in a particular way and re-enforce particular patterns (like judging / bashing myself).

So now I already had quite a package deal for myself to influence my behaviour and attitude through writing, thinking, drawing, reading and watching. It was really quite the undertaking and required my constant engagement in either ways to keep myself going. It was literally a full-time job where any moment of non-participation in any of these points would immediately show/reflect in how I was doing in terms of sticking to my plan – where there would be drop in motivation and commitment.

This was quite an insightful experience, because I had never worked with myself in this way in terms of my thoughts, emotions and writing – and discovered quite a bit in terms of how these things can be used as tools to ‘change’ yourself. A memory popped up yesterday after writing my blog, well, not a memory per se but more of a conglomeration of memories which all focused on the same point. I was basically looking at all the friendships I’ve had during my life and how I never really ‘tied’ myself with these people. Whenever something would get ‘off’ or ‘ugly’ in our friendships, I’d just back off and that was it. I didn’t like how things were going so I would stop talking to them, going out with them and then after a while they’d just be strangers to me. It wasn’t ‘immediate’ meaning, I would still talk to them but less and less and I would stop going out with them to do stuff and then one day these things would then accumulate to us no longer being friends.

And I can remember a lot of the moments with specific friends where they were doing something / acting in a particular way , showing a side of themselves that they’d never shown before and I would go “Woah, what the hell is this?” and within that moment, immediately make the decision to ‘back off’ like “Okay, I’m done here” and that was that. I also never created any emotional bonds with any of the people/friends I hung out with. When we’d be together and do stuff we’d have fun but when I was not with them I couldn’t care less about them. And if after ‘breaking up’ they would come around and be all emotional about us not being friends anymore I’d just kind of shrug my shoulders and move on. During my friendships I would also not really bother to do anything to ‘maintain’ our friendships. If they didn’t call me or ask me to do stuff, then it wouldn’t happen. I saw a lot of my friends being very engaged in their friendships and doing things together and always calling / sharing stuff and I thought it was too much of a hassle. I liked being by myself and would for instance rather read a book at home then go out with friends, I liked my ‘me ‘ time lol.

All throughout my life I kind of jumped from one friendship to another, where each time when a nasty side was revealed, I backed off and found someone else, until they showed a nasty side, and then I would jump again. If I look at my friendships/relationships throughout my life, I never had a real, intimate, deep, long lasting relationship with anyone.

In a way it was cool in terms that I wasn’t “tied” to anyone and have always been able to move on quite fine without having to deal with any emotional garbage, yet at the same time I now also see it as a pity because I never really developed any intimate relationships which could have actually been cool.

If I look at it now, even the points where the friends would show a ‘nasty’ side or something I didn’t like – I still see it as reflecting back to the intimacy point, where instead of talking to them and sorting the point out, I rather did nothing and just remove myself, because I saw this point of opening up about whatever I saw, as a point of intimacy, and I just didn’t want to go there. It’s almost like, any point where any of my relationships would become ‘real’ – where a point opens up such as nastiness, if I were to address this point, then I would be admitting to myself that my relationship with this person is real, and within that – that the person is real! And the moment the person is real, in terms of being just like me – that’s some serious shit. Because if my friend is ‘real’ just like me, and goes through stuff just like me, then this implies a point of responsibility to be there for them. And then the question arises: Can I do that? Do I even want to do that? And so far, this answer has always been No, where I don’t want to address a point which would require addressing if I were to remain their friend, and where I don’t want to open myself up because of fear and lack of confidence and where I don’t want to get intimate with people because I fear I will get ‘sucked in’ – where this “sucked in” is just my interpretation of seeing that point of responsibility and not wanting to commit myself to develop an actual relationship with another as myself.

You see, a few months, maybe a year, before I got all into spirituality, I basically ‘made’ myself be somewhat ‘anorexic’. Throughout my life I had always been fascinated by anorexic girls and how they had the willpower to abstain from food (I mean, I LOVE FOOD). Then the one day, I was watching a documentary on tv about some anorexic girls, which give a pretty good picture of their thought patterns, as those became apparent during the interviews with them. So then I thought, “Hey, instead of anorexia “happening” to me like a “disease”, I could just manage my thoughts, and deliberately think the way they do, and manage it that way!”. This might sound very weird, but I was very bored with my life at that time, and I was looking for a ‘goal’, something to achieve, a ‘purpose’ to give my life direction. So then, that’s what I did.

I found it very exciting to play this ‘secret game’, always having to make sure my family wouldn’t take notice in this change of “lifestyle” that I had adopted. I started losing a lot of weight and getting a lot of compliments from the people around me. I absolutely loved it.

At times when I was down I would take my diary and write out my “managed thoughts”, to kind of ‘force them’ into reality – and surprisingly it worked! I found that writing was very effective in terms of re-enforcing the behaviour that I was looking for within myself. I’d also flip through fashion magazines, keep a scrap book where I kept the best model pictures – and when I was really having a ‘dip’ or a bad day in terms of ‘not eating food’, I’d take one of the images and re-draw them in my diary. I got so good at constantly forcing myself to think about losing weight and calories and exercising  -- that it just became an automated part of me and I didn’t have to ‘deliberately’ do it anymore – it had just become me.

So when I came to the point where I was like “Fuck, this is getting out of hand (I was very drowsy, feeling nauseas, sometimes feeling like I was about the faint), I’ve got to stop this.” I tried, but then I noticed how this whole new behaviour had just “taken over” and I had lost control. The thoughts, the pictures in my head – they just kept coming!

I eventually got over it, but it took a whole long while to get there.
